Update of /cvsroot/linux-mips/linux/include/asm-mips
In directory usw-pr-cvs1:/tmp/cvs-serv10446
Modified Files:
checksum.h
Log Message:
Some gcc versions don't seem to like the +r constraint.
Index: checksum.h
===================================================================
RCS file: /cvsroot/linux-mips/linux/include/asm-mips/checksum.h,v
retrieving revision 1.5
retrieving revision 1.6
diff -u -d -r1.5 -r1.6
--- checksum.h 2001/10/31 18:26:52 1.5
+++ checksum.h 2001/11/20 18:11:19 1.6
@@ -79,9 +79,10 @@
"addu\t%0,$1\n\t"
"xori\t%0,0xffff\n\t"
".set\tat"
- : "+r" (sum));
+ : "=r" (sum)
+ : "r" (sum));
- return sum;
+ return sum;
}
/*
|